areic dose rate

symbol: $G$

Areic dose introduced into a solid in time interval \(t\) divided by \(t\).
Note: For a stationary parallel beam, the areic dose rate equals the flux times \(\cos\ \theta\), where \(\theta\) is the angle of incidence of the beam.
